Where do contractors view paystubs? Or, how do you resend an invite for Workforce to an existing contractor? That option seems to only be available to employees.

When setting up new contractors, Intuit will automatically send a link to set up. However, if that user doesn't log in or not often, they lose their access. How can I resend that link?

To confirm, yes, QuickBooks Workforce is for employees to view their paycheck details, time off balances, and total pay for the year. Thus, inviting your contractors to see their pay stubs isn't possible.

 

On the other hand, if you mean letting your contractors add their own tax info, you can resend the invitation by clicking the Send a reminder link from the contractor's profile.

 

Here's how:

 

  1. Go to Payroll then click on Contractors.
  2. Choose the contractor’s name.
  3. Hit on Send a reminder or Send an email.

 

After clicking the send a reminder option, your contractor will receive an email invitation link.
